Recurring Task Standards tab in Labor Standards
Use the Recurring Task Standards tab in the Standards pane in Labor Standards to specify standards for fixed work. Fixed work is any recurring task that is expected to be completed within a set amount of time. For example, cleaning duties lend themselves to task standards as each activity, such as a monthly deep cleaning task, has its own time requirement. The standards you create for this periodic fixed work are added to the day's labor requirement for the defined periods.
Note: This tab is only available if the Standard Type is set to KBI Related. For more information, see Configuring Planner Settings.
Note: The Standards pane is available only if a job or assignment/sub-assignment is selected. The Standards pane is not available at the property, division, or department levels.
